Arts and Design Division

The Arts and Design Division seeks to educate the total artist. An art curriculum based on a liberal arts core provides a foundation in the visual arts, new ways of seeing, and a grounding in fundamental art techniques. Course are designed to promote:

  • the awareness, appreciation and responsiveness to all forms of art, traditional as well as emerging art forms
  • the development of a unique creative expression that reflects one's individual experience, perceptions, concepts
  • critical judgment to understand the various styles of esthetic taste
  • the ability to use the language of art as a means of communication

Art faculty are practicing artists and the ratio of faculty to students, overall, is about 1:10, translating into more individual attention. The division offers programs in:
